mit onsubmit mehrere aktionen ausführen
richy
- html
0 ChrisB
Hallo,
ich möchte beim mabsenden meines Formulars mehrere vom Rückgabewert abhängige Aktionen ausführen.
Eine Funktion kein Problem, jedochg mit der Kombination von beiden.
<FORM name="Formular" METHOD=get ACTION="/cgi-bin/gaestebuch.cgi" onsubmit="return checkname(); setTimeout('document.Formular.reset();', 3000); return true;" target="buch">
Als erstes soll beim absenden die Funktion "checkname" aufgerufen werden, mit dem Rückgabewert "true" soll das Formular versendet werden. Wiederum mit dem Rückgabewert "true" (vom versenden) soll die Funktion "setTimeout usw" aufgerufen werden und das Formular gelöscht (Reset) werden.
mfg
richy
Hi,
ich möchte beim mabsenden meines Formulars mehrere vom Rückgabewert abhängige Aktionen ausführen.
Eine Funktion kein Problem, jedochg mit der Kombination von beiden.<FORM name="Formular" METHOD=get ACTION="/cgi-bin/gaestebuch.cgi" onsubmit="return checkname(); setTimeout('document.Formular.reset();', 3000); return true;" target="buch">
return springt sofort aus dem aktuellen Anweisungweisungsblock zurueck an die aufrufende Stelle.
Nach deinem Aufruf von checkname passiert hier also exakt nichts mehr.
MfG ChrisB